Use copper plugs, nothing fancy. Bosch W5DC or W7DC. $2 each.
Avoid todays new fangled 2-4 electrode, platinum, gold plated pimp my ride gimmick plugs. Keep it simple. |
Check AFR's. Borrow LM1 from someone and do a run. If AFR's are >13.50 @ WOT then you need to richen it.
If they are OK, blow compressed air trough main engine oilcooler. You can also try to clean in underneath with pressurized water hose. If that doesn't help, fiddle with ignition. |

retarded timing wont make it run hot, it is the other way around. when the timing is advanced, the combustion temp goes up causing preignition. that is why u have to richen the mixture when u advance timing. with the mileage on the car, u could have oil and other debris blocking the ais flow over the cooler. u might want to remove the engine oil cooler and have it cleaned |

i felt like i was sticking my neck out on that on. i did a lot of research on the net under spark plugs and timing because my car was running hot and it was detonating under load. in the end it was the CAM timing and a bad thermostat that was the problem. cams are the main thing that have to do with when and how much hot gas escapes. the ign timimg just determines WHEN they start to burn. google "reading sparkplugs" the drag racers have it down to a science, also search cam timing. i have learned how air/fuel mixture,timing,plug gap and heat range affect each other, now if i can just figure out what to do with it! |

If you live in Florida I would most block this left side off. BUT! do not give up the Blower Motor and the ducts to the heat exchangers as these will help keep the exchangers cool and overall help with your temp troubles. This also means you MUST have a Blower Motor that is working! The Blower Motor will just draw it's air intake from the engine bay and not from the Left Side of the air shroud. I had a 75 911S and caped off my left side with Metal Flashing much like the pie tin idea already mentioned, this works just fine. |
